  7. Alright so I don't speak highly of myself often, but I'm proud of myself and I wanna share it with you guys. I have went from 347 in January to 312 pounds this morning. I went from NEVER exercising to working out 4 to 5 times a week 45 minutes to an hour usually in the morning but sometimes in the afternoon too. In 5 weeks my average calorie intake has been about 1200 when it used to be well over 3000. Instead of eating fast food 7 or 8 times a week, I do it maybe once a week and when I do I don't go for the double quarter pounder, I go for a grilled chicken sandwich and yogurt at chick fila. I've been working so hard and all my clothes (that used to be a 5x t shirt and a 30-32 pants size) all fit nice and baggy and I'm actually going to buy a belt this week for the first time since high school. It feels so good to say these things. I go for my second fill on Monday, and I was thinking how nice it would be for us march bandsters to share some of the positives in our lives! We're doing it guys! One pound at a time......

  14. Got food stuck for the first time today. I was banded 3/6 and I had my first fill almost 2 weeks ago. I felt no restriction, I mean NONE! But, I have been eating cautious bites just in case. Today I was distracted and took a big bite of salad with cucumber and BAM. Crazy, painful chest/upper stomach pain. Hurt bad and felt like I was gonna puke. Ran and got some water, and took a couple of sips. The water hurt too and I felt water backing up in my esophagus. And then, like a tiny miracle, it went through just like that. Instant better. At least I think that was stuck food......
